
Despite the similarity in name to Gruner Veltliner, this native Austrian varietal is not related to Gruner at all. It is a unique and very old grape beloved for its rich flavor profile. An abundance of white berries and florals on the nose lead to a palate replete with fresh acidity and a somewhat nutty characteristic. A gorgeous pairing for pork schnitzel, seafood, or tahihi-rich dips.
